Moon shot: The Allentown Symphony, with Diane Wittry, Music Director-Conductor, presents “To The Moon And Back!,” 7 p.m. May 4, State Theatre Center for the Arts, Easton. The concert by the acclaimed ASO celebrates the 50th anniversary of the moon landing with spectacular music accompanied by photos from NASA. Where were you on July 20, 1969, when Neil Armstrong and Buzz Aldrin took mankind’s first steps on the lunar surface? The concert program includes: Debussy’s “Clair de Lune,” Beethoven’s “Moonlight Sonata,” John Williams’ “Star Wars,” Holst’s “The Planets: Mars, The Bringer of War,” and Horner’s “Theme from Apollo 13.” Free with your ticket is a lecture by Todd Sullivan, “100 Billion Earths: The Future of Space Science,” 5:30 p.m. May 4, Acopian Ballroom. Fun, Fun, Fun: Civic Theatre of Allentown presents the Lehigh Valley production premiere of “Fun Home,” May 3-19. The Tony Award-winning musical traces the coming-of-age of lesbian author Alison Bechdel, from her youth, to her years at Oberlin College, and to the present. Alison reflects on her past, struggling to make sense of it, particularly her relationship with her father, Bruce, and her brothers, John and Christian. Music is by Jeanine Tesori. Book and lyrics are by Lisa Kron, based on the memoir, “Fun Home: A Family Tragicomic,” by Alison Bechdel. Director and Choreographer is William Ross Sanders. Music Director is Nick Conti.
